Castlevania: Lords of Shadow 2 is an action-adventure game set in a modern world where players control Dracula as he confronts new threats after events from the prior title. The experience centers on melee combat, exploration of urban and castle environments, and progression through a linear narrative that mixes platforming with ability upgrades.
Gameplay
The core loop revolves around controlling Dracula in third-person perspective during combat encounters against various enemies. Basic attacks combine with special moves powered by collected relics, which provide temporary enhancements or transformations. The Transmutation Rune from the Relic Rune Pack lets players absorb discovered relics and convert them into others already found, ensuring flexibility when facing different enemy types or situations. This system activates after obtaining the first relic and supports repeated use throughout the campaign.
Dracula gains access to blood-based abilities and shape-shifting options that alter movement and attack patterns. Exploration involves navigating city streets and larger structures, with some sections requiring careful positioning to avoid detection. Relics serve as key collectibles that tie directly into combat effectiveness, and the rune addition streamlines management by reducing the need to hunt for specific items in each area.

Is It Worth Playing?
Reception for Castlevania: Lords of Shadow 2 has been mixed, with critics noting repetitive combat encounters and uneven stealth sections that detract from the overall flow. User feedback highlights the appeal of playing as Dracula and the satisfaction of mastering relic combinations, though many mention the story pacing and hand-holding elements as drawbacks. The Relic Rune Pack addresses one common pain point by improving relic versatility, which can make combat feel more adaptable during longer sessions.
The title suits players interested in action-adventure experiences with strong melee focus and gothic themes, particularly those who enjoy experimenting with ability systems. Availability on PC keeps it accessible for those seeking a complete single-player run without ongoing seasonal content or live updates. Those sensitive to dated mechanics or linear storytelling may find the campaign less engaging after the initial hours.
